I'm with Oren on this. I specified a properly-sized Heyco strain relief for a
medical product and it easily passed the U.L. cord pull test at the U.L. testing
facility here in Northbrook, IL. Heyco also makes the proper tool for affixing
the strain relief to the panel. Don't use common "pliers" for this task!
